The German Drugstore Phenomenon: More Than Just a Pharmacy
When tourists or expats initial step into a German drugstore-- known in your area as the Drogerie-- they are frequently amazed by what they find. Unlike pharmacies in countries like the United States or the United Kingdom, which lean greatly toward pharmaceuticals and convenience items, the German drugstore is an enormous, thoroughly curated wonderland of cosmetics, natural groceries, family goods, and wellness items.
If you are preparing a journey to Germany, moving, or merely curious about German customer culture, comprehending the Drogerie landscape is essential. Let's take a deep dive into the pharmacy culture in Germany, explore the biggest gamers, and uncover why these stores are precious organizations.

Founded in 1973, dm is a cultural example in Germany. Germans consistently vote dm as their preferred seller. The stores are carefully organized, wheelchair- and stroller-friendly, and lit with warm, welcoming lighting. dm is especially popular for pioneering the "private label" revolution in Germany, providing premium-quality cosmetics and skin care at a fraction of the cost of name brand names.
2. Dirk Rossmann GmbH (Rossmann)
As the second-largest chain, Rossmann is common across German towns and cities. Rossmann is understood for aggressive discounting, weekly discount coupon books, and a fantastic digital app. While its store design can sometimes feel slightly more utilitarian than dm, its item variety is equally remarkable.
3. Müller
Müller differ because it works nearly like a mini-department store. While it has the very same substantial drugstore and natural food sections as dm and Rossmann, a common Müller will also include a huge toy department, a stationery and book section, and a high-end luxury fragrance counter.

The Magic of German Drugstore House Brands (Eigenmarken)
Among the greatest secrets of the German drugstore is the quality of its private-label brands. In many countries, store-brand products are deemed cheap, inferior options to call brand names. In Germany, the opposite is typically true.
German customer magazines (like Stiftung Warentest) regularly test pharmacy house brands against high-end brand names, and Eigenmarken often win top honors for quality, component safety, and value.
